Abstract

Generally, the present disclosure is directed to metal-to-metal sealing systems and methods for use with the various pressure-retaining components, and in particular to pressure-retaining components that may be used in mudline suspension systems. In one illustrative embodiment, a system is disclosed that includes a first pressure-retaining component having an outside face, the outside face including first and second metal sealing surfaces proximate an end of the first pressure-retaining component, wherein the second metal sealing surface is positioned along the outside face between the first metal sealing surface and the end of the first pressure-retaining component. The system further includes, among other things, a second pressure-retaining component having an inside face, the inside face of the second pressure-retaining component including a third metal sealing surface that is adapted to sealingly engage at least the first metal sealing surface.
